Controlling information capacity of binary neural network

被引:13
|
作者
Ignatov, Dmitry [1 ]
Ignatov, Andrey [2 ]
机构
[1] Huawei Technol, Russian Res Ctr, Moscow 121614, Russia
[2] Swiss Fed Inst Technol, Dept Comp Sci, CH-8092 Zurich, Switzerland
关键词
Deep learning; Binary neural network; Information theory; Shannon entropy;
D O I
10.1016/j.patrec.2020.07.033
中图分类号
TP18 [人工智能理论];
学科分类号
081104 ; 0812 ; 0835 ; 1405 ;
摘要
Despite the growing popularity of deep learning technologies, high memory requirements and power consumption are essentially limiting their application in mobile and IoT areas. While binary convolutional networks can alleviate these problems, the limited bitwidth of weights is often leading to significant degradation of prediction accuracy. In this paper, we present a method for training binary networks that maintains a stable predefined level of their information capacity throughout the training process by applying Shannon entropy based penalty to convolutional filters. The results of experiments conducted on the SVHN, CIFAR and ImageNet datasets demonstrate that the proposed approach can statistically significantly improve the accuracy of binary networks. (C) 2020 Elsevier B.V. All rights reserved.
引用
收藏
页码:276 / 281
页数:6
相关论文
共 50 条
  • [41] DeltaNet: Differential Binary Neural Network
    Oba, Yuka
    Ando, Kota
    Asai, Tetsuya
    Motomura, Masato
    Takamaeda-Yamazaki, Shinya
    2019 IEEE 30TH INTERNATIONAL CONFERENCE ON APPLICATION-SPECIFIC SYSTEMS, ARCHITECTURES AND PROCESSORS (ASAP 2019), 2019, : 39 - 39
  • [42] BICONN:: A binary competitive neural network
    Muñoz-Pérez, J
    García-Bernal, MA
    de Guevara-López, IL
    Gomez-Ruiz, JA
    COMPUTATIONAL METHODS IN NEURAL MODELING, PT 1, 2003, 2686 : 430 - 437
  • [43] A comprehensive review of Binary Neural Network
    Yuan, Chunyu
    Agaian, Sos S.
    ARTIFICIAL INTELLIGENCE REVIEW, 2023, 56 (11) : 12949 - 13013
  • [44] Dual Path Binary Neural Network
    Chen, Pei-Yin
    Tang, Chi-Huan
    Chen, Wei-Ting
    Yu, Hui-Liang
    2019 INTERNATIONAL SOC DESIGN CONFERENCE (ISOCC), 2019, : 251 - 252
  • [45] Partially activated neural networks by controlling information
    Kamimura, Ryotaro
    ARTIFICIAL NEURAL NETWORKS - ICANN 2007, PT 1, PROCEEDINGS, 2007, 4668 : 480 - 489
  • [46] Artificial Neural Network for Binary and Multiclassification of Network Attacks
    Omarov, Bauyrzhan
    Kostangeldinova, Alma
    Tukenova, Lyailya
    Mambetaliyeva, Gulsara
    Madiyarova, Almira
    Amirgaliyev, Beibut
    Kulambayev, Bakhytzhan
    INTERNATIONAL JOURNAL OF ADVANCED COMPUTER SCIENCE AND APPLICATIONS, 2023, 14 (07) : 729 - 736
  • [47] Binary Graph Convolutional Network With Capacity Exploration
    Wang, Junfu
    Guo, Yuanfang
    Yang, Liang
    Wang, Yunhong
    IEEE TRANSACTIONS ON PATTERN ANALYSIS AND MACHINE INTELLIGENCE, 2024, 46 (05) : 3031 - 3046
  • [48] Artificial neural network as an applicable tool to predict the binary heat capacity of mixtures containing ionic liquids
    Lashkarbolooki, Mostafa
    Hezave, Ali Zeinolabedini
    Ayatollahi, Shahab
    FLUID PHASE EQUILIBRIA, 2012, 324 : 102 - 107
  • [49] Neural network algorithm controlling a hexapod platform
    Pernechele, C
    Bortoletto, F
    Giro, E
    IJCNN 2000: PROCEEDINGS OF THE IEEE-INNS-ENNS INTERNATIONAL JOINT CONFERENCE ON NEURAL NETWORKS, VOL IV, 2000, : 349 - 352
  • [50] The neural network as a renormalizer of information
    Miranker, Willard L.
    QUARTERLY OF APPLIED MATHEMATICS, 2008, 66 (02) : 379 - 394